Shawn, when we came down to your track for the SWRC race and ran the track clockwise all of us in the stock 125 class were geared at a 15/24,and turned times in the high 39's on Sat. Sun was hotter and a flat 40 was our best.This was on Brigestone "C"s for the event,if you run MG yellows it could shave off a 1/2 second or more we find.

just got back from running my crg with a cr125 modified.
put a 17-24 on for gearing need to add gear going to 17-25=1.47
top speed was 81-82 mph at the end of the straight.my speed will go down but lap times will be better. I practice on mondays , because it my day off.
